Just because people have gone all in blind at the table doesn't mean we should assume the whole table is going to play a certain way. Do people make 3x pot overbets sometimes and show up with a way overvalued hand? Yes. That's the funny story - exception to the rule. I'm much more confident in living by the rule, which is that 3x pot overbets are hands that have 1 pair beat.


I'm folding here unless villan is a maniac or spewy player. Also, I'm making it at least $20 to go preflop.
